Well I think Jose's tactics were spot on tonight. Attack from the kick off and keep attacking until we score. We did that and dominated the first half easily. The second half was obviously defend what we have but continue to catch them with a counter attack. We came very close on numerous occasions to scoring more goals.

Fantastic goal by Joe Cole, masterfully made by Drogba who was supplied a sublime pass by Carvalho. Frank came very close twice but was denied on both occasions by 2 great saves by Reina. Drog had 2 headers that were close too.

I thought that all departments did their job well tonight. The defence was a wall, the midfield didn't allow a lot to get through and the forwards attacked enough to restict Liverpool committing too many men forward. Perfect scenario in my opinion.

The fact that Liverpool couldn't score a vital way goal was just as important as Chelsea scoring. The onus is on the visiting team to score that crucial away goal, and if they don't score it, that is in itself a good achievement. We went one better. We scored too.

It must be obvious to all by now that Chelsea are very comfortable just soaking up whatever is thrown at them. Falling back and soaking up the pressure is something that Chelsea do very well and to great effect. Some people out there think that its the other team that push us back. They still don't realise that to fall back, defend and contain and then counter is a tactic that Chelsea use in almost every game they play.

I heard a commentator on the radio say that "Liverpool dominated the second half". No they did not. Another commentator who has obviously not seen Chelsea play much this season I suspect. Almost every time Liverpool attempted to penetrate, they were allowed to advance only so far and then either the Chelsea midfielders or defenders fought for possession. When they did manage a shot on goal, Cech made a great save to deny Gerrard.

Tonight the team worked well as a unit and with Essien back for the second leg at Anfield, we are in pole position for the Final. They HAVE to score but they also have to stop us scoring. I'm looking forward to it.
